Transaction 98cd9079170bb74fae29ab4c4cc71fadf86fe39fb8ac9d84f2154bf813a9630e
1 Input
1 Output
-
98cd9079170bb74fae29ab4c4cc71fadf86fe39fb8ac9d84f2154bf813a9630e:0
- value
- 5098785
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ddbc788e507d12c186355dfa25277defc95acbf0
- address
- bc1qmk783rjs05fvrp34thaz2fmaaly44jlsprt2k3